AWS Architect with Dynamo DB

AWS Architect with Dynamo DB

Posted 2 weeks ago by 1752834735

Negotiable
Outside
Remote
USA

Summary: We are looking for a skilled Software Engineer specializing in Amazon DynamoDB and AWS Lambda to design, develop, and maintain high-performance applications for credit rating operations. The role involves optimizing database performance and collaborating with teams to deliver new features. The position is remote and classified as outside IR35.

Key Responsibilities:

  • Design, develop, and deploy serverless applications using AWS Lambda.
  • Implement and manage NoSQL databases using Amazon DynamoDB.
  • Optimize DynamoDB performance, including indexing, partitioning, and query optimization.
  • Develop and maintain data models and schemas for DynamoDB to support application requirements.
  • Implement data migration and replication strategies for DynamoDB.
  • Monitor and troubleshoot DynamoDB performance issues and ensure high availability.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Ensure the performance, quality, and responsiveness of applications.
  • Identify and correct bottlenecks and fix bugs.
  • Help maintain code quality, organization, and automation.

Key Skills:

  • Expertise in Amazon DynamoDB.
  • Proficiency in AWS Lambda.
  • Experience in designing and developing serverless applications.
  • Strong understanding of NoSQL databases.
  • Ability to optimize database performance.
  • Experience with data modeling and schema design.
  • Knowledge of data migration and replication strategies.
  • Strong troubleshooting skills.
  • Ability to collaborate with cross-functional teams.
  • Commitment to code quality and automation.

Salary (Rate): undetermined

City: undetermined

Country: USA

Working Arrangements: remote

IR35 Status: outside IR35

Seniority Level: undetermined

Industry: IT

Detailed Description From Employer:

We are seeking a highly skilled Software Engineer with expertise in Amazon DynamoDB, and AWS Lambda to join our dynamic team. In this role, you will be responsible for designing, developing, and maintaining scalable and high-performance applications that support our clients credit rating operations.

Key Responsibilities:

Design, develop, and deploy serverless applications using AWS Lambda.

Implement and manage NoSQL databases using Amazon DynamoDB.

Optimize DynamoDB performance, including indexing, partitioning, and query optimization.

Develop and maintain data models and schemas for DynamoDB to support application requirements.

Implement data migration and replication strategies for DynamoDB.

Monitor and troubleshoot DynamoDB performance issues and ensure high availability.

Collaborate with cross-functional teams to define, design, and ship new features.

Ensure the performance, quality, and responsiveness of applications.

Identify and correct bottlenecks and fix bugs.

Help maintain code quality, organization, and automation